‘Roseanne’ Getting Revival With Roseanne Barr, John Goodman, Sara Gilbert & Co.

One of the biggest comedies of the 1990s, Roseanne, is making a comeback. I hear an eight-episode limited series revival of the hit ABC blue-collar family comedy is in the works with the key cast members reprising their roles, including Roseanne Barr, John Goodman and Sara Gilbert, with Laurie Metcalf and others in the process of joining them. The new installment, produced by the original series’ executive producers Tom Werner, Barr and Bruce Helford as well as Gilbert and Whitney Cummings, is currently in the marketplace, with multiple networks bidding, including Roseanne original home ABC, and Netflix, which has been staging reboots of classic sitcoms, including Full House and One Day At a Time, along with new installments of cult favorites Arrested Development and Gilmore Girls.

 

Roseanne remains a gold standard for its realistic portrayal of a working-class American family. It centered on the Conners who lived, barely scraping by, in the fictional town of Lanford, Illinois. The revival comes as networks, and particularly ABC, are making a concerted effort to better reflect the lives of everyday Americans.

 

I hear the intent is for all principal Roseanne actors to appear in some capacity in the reboot, including The Big Bang Theory star Johnny Galecki.

 

Roseanne, produced by indie Carsey-Werner, was a big ratings hit and ran for nine seasons on ABC. Next month, May 20, 2017, marks the 20th anniversary of the Roseanne series finale, which drew 16 million viewers. The family sitcom earned Emmy nominations for Barr, Goodman, Metcalf and Gilbert, with Barr winning one and Metcalf three statuettes.

 

In 2009, on her website Barr gave her detailed take on where each of the main characters from the show would be in a possible Roseanne revival — Roseanne and Jackie opening the first medical marijuana dispensary in Lanford; Dan reappearing alive after faking his death; DJ being published; Mark dying in Iraq; David leaving Darlene for a woman half his age; Darlene coming out, meeting a woman and having a baby with her; Becky working at Walmart; Arnie befriending the Governor of Illinois and remarrying Nancy, Bev selling a painting for $10,000; Jerry and the grandsons forming a boy band; and Bonnie being arrested for selling crack.

Rumor: Rosanne cast might get a new show (without rosanne)

Quote

Here’s the challenge, though: Roseanne was created by Roseanne Barr. The characters were conceived by her and Matt Williams. If the sitcom were to continue without the matriarch, the actress would still benefit financially. So a key insider informs EW that discussions will continue today on whether it makes sense to keep the other actors but potentially design a new series around them — ergo, the Bonners, or whatever you want to call Goodman, Metcalf, and the clan of misfits. Nothing has been decided, however, and various options are still being weighed.
